<p><strong>Stock Risers – Tight Ends</strong><br>Big is the name of the game here. These 10 tight ends have made major jumps in our rankings, and it's easy to see why. They bring a rare mix of size, athleticism, and playmaking ability. Each of them has a huge frame and an even bigger impact on the field.</p>

<p class="text-gray-700"><strong>[player_tooltip player_id='1608324' first='Troy' last='Alderfer'] | Christ The King | 6'5” 235</strong><br>Alderfer is a handful to deal with at tight end. At 6'5, 235, blocking comes naturally to him, and he delivers it with consistency. The biggest question mark is the level of competition he faces, but his talent is undeniable. He has soft, reliable hands, and while his offense hasn't given him many pass-catching opportunities in the past, preseason film suggests that could change this year. Expect his role in the passing game to expand.</p>

<p class="text-gray-700"><strong>[player_tooltip player_id='1252939' first='Hayes' last='Brawner'] | Millbrook | 6'6</strong> <strong>235</strong><br>Brawner is an under-the-radar talent primed for a breakout season. At 6'6, he's been a major factor in the run game, serving primarily as a blocker last year while seeing only one or two targets per game. That's set to change this season, as his size and athleticism should make him a much bigger weapon in the passing attack.</p>

<p class="text-gray-700"><strong>[player_tooltip player_id='1607810' first='Qualteau' last='Hawkins'] | Stuart Cramer | 6'3” 240</strong><br>Hawkins is one of the biggest mismatch problems in the 704. At 6'3, 240, he combines size with surprising athleticism, routinely making plays in the passing game that most players his size simply can't. He already holds a couple of Power Four offers, and with an expected uptick in production this season, his stock could rise even higher.</p>

<p class="text-gray-700"><strong>[player_tooltip player_id='1572063' first='Kenneth' last='Best IV'] | Atkins | 6'2” 220</strong><br>Atkins will be leaning on Best to play a major role in the offense this season. At 6'2, 220, he's a strong blocker with the footwork of a running back, giving him the versatility to impact both the run and passing game.</p>

<p class="text-gray-700"><strong>[player_tooltip player_id='1125763' first='Alex' last='Haywood'] | Providence | 6'5” 225</strong><br>Haywood burst onto the scene as a freshman, scoring double-digit touchdowns and establishing himself as a go-to weapon. His sophomore campaign was cut short by a lower leg injury, but after a strong rehab process and a productive 7v7 season, he's back at full strength. At 6'5, 225, Haywood is a massive target with receiver-like speed and hands. Expect him to return to his freshman form and once again push for double-digit touchdowns.</p>

<p class="text-gray-700"><strong>[player_tooltip player_id='1665263' first='Braeden' last='Vetter'] | Williams | 6'3” 215</strong><br>Vetter is a phenomenal prospect with all the tools to be special. While his production hasn't matched some of the other tight ends on this list, the talent is unquestionably there. Used primarily as a run-game asset up to this point, he's expected to see a significant increase in targets this season, which should showcase his full potential.</p>

<p class="text-gray-700"><strong>[player_tooltip player_id='718315' first='Hudson' last='Nolden'] | Palisades | 6'3” 210</strong><br>Nolden is a big target for a Palisades program that continues to rise. The new school on the south side of Charlotte has already produced several elite prospects, and Nolden looks to be the next in line. He's equally effective in the run game and the passing attack, and on a loaded roster this season, he's primed to be a true difference-maker.</p>

<p class="text-gray-700"><strong>[player_tooltip player_id='668611' first='Drew' last='Easter'] | Southeast Alamance | 6'4” 223</strong><br>Easter is a true mismatch in the secondary. With elite ball skills, he can catch anything thrown his way, and at 6'4, 223, he's stronger than most linemen—more than capable of moving defenders out of his path. Earlier this offseason at a 7v7 event, he stood out as the top tight end on the field. Easter is a diamond in the rough whose stock should continue to climb.</p>

<p class="text-gray-700"><strong>[player_tooltip player_id='1607846' first='Noah' last='Congleton'] | Martin County | 6'5” 210</strong><br>Congleton is a red-zone threat with the ability to stretch the field as well. At 6'5, 210, he makes spectacular catches look routine. Last season he hauled in 13 passes, five of them for touchdowns. With more opportunities in the passing game, he has the talent to push for double-digit scores.</p>

<p class="text-gray-700"><strong>[player_tooltip player_id='1718784' first='Phoenix' last='Barnes'] | 6'5” 210</strong><br>Barnes is the prototype tight end prospect. At 6'5, 210, he brings the full package—route-running ability, blocking strength, and a big frame that creates natural mismatches. Still an up-and-coming talent, he has the tools to rise quickly, and with the right opportunities, he could develop into one of the top tight ends not just in the area, but across the state.</p>
